GGuest User 2025.06.06
The location is very convenient, about 3 kilometers from the US border, and it is very convenient to take a taxi. It is within 1 km from the bar street and 400 to 500 meters from Revolution Avenue, which can be walked. The room is really big and the hygiene is OK. When I first entered the room, I felt that the smell was a bit strong but it was acceptable. After a while, I may get used to it. Please note that the hotel does not have luggage storage service. When I was about to check out, I asked the front desk and found out that I could not store my luggage. They said there was no place. I asked if there was any other place to store my luggage, but they didn’t know. Later, I had to pay 20 US dollars to delay the check-out until 3 pm.
